  • Abstract
    We consider a multi-agent network of second-order dynamics and study its resilient consensus taking account of cyber security issues. In our setting, some of the agents may be malicious whose aim is to prevent other normal agents from reaching consensus. They may do so by not following the given control laws and behaving arbitrarily. It is assumed that the total number of such agents in the network is known. The normal agents are equipped with a simple algorithm where neighbors taking the largest and smallest values are ignored to avoid being influenced by malicious agents. We address this problem when the inter-agent communication have bounded time-varying delays with an emphasis on networks of vehicles. Topological conditions in terms of graph robustness are developed.
